Although the format has changed over the years, Mojang has traditionally hosted events to reveal big announcements. minecraft. The developer has started hosting an annual offline convention called Minecon. But with the first Minecraft Live taking place in 2020, things shifted to an online-only setup. The format changed again in 2025, when Mojang began hosting two Minecraft Live presentations each year, one in the spring and one in the fall. For context, the last presentation took place on September 27, 2025 and explored features from both The Copper Age and Mounts of Mayhem.

Minecraft Live launches on March 21st
With 2026 well underway, Mojang has announced that the next Minecraft Live presentation will take place on March 21 at 1 PM EDT. A trailer for the presentation has been released. The developer also noted that fans can take a look at upcoming game drops along with behind-the-scenes content, guest appearances, and other “exciting stuff” during the event. For those who want to watch, the presentation is available on the game's official YouTube and Twitch channels, along with Minecraft.net.

What will we see at the first Minecraft Live in 2026?
There's no word yet on what specifically will be shown at Minecraft Live on March 21, but fans should get a first look at the second game drop for 2026. Additionally, Mojang will likely reveal a release date for the Tiny Takeover game drop. If things proceed similarly with Minecraft Live 2025 edition, the first major update of the year could be released shortly after the event, possibly before the end of March. With launch imminent, players will be getting a thorough look at Tiny Takeover's content. Since announcing the game's release in January, we've been able to test many of its features through Java snapshots and Bedrock betas/previews. As the name suggests, the game drop introduces many new versions of existing baby mobs, making the overworld look even cuter. The developers are also adding golden dandelions. minecraft. This craftable item gives players the power to prevent baby mobs from aging.
